The Primary Girls did it again! Eighteen girls played in brilliant August weather last Saturday at Lighthouse Oval in a very entertaining match for their enthusiastic spectators.
The game began in fast pace with the Blues on fire and scoring early. It looked as though the game would be theirs as further goals were scored by their forwards after brilliant defence by their mids, backs and goalie.
However, with a number of goals behind, the Reds retaliated and after a couple of runs and wide shots, they were rewarded with a couple of successes.
With twenty minutes remaining and still trailing, the Red team put the Blues under pressure and attacked with determination to quickly score further goals. The game was excellent proof that
'Quitters never win and winners never quit !'
Well done to all the girls, whose efforts at training are paying off in match play.
